Web[In this image] This worm is an adult female Ascaris lumbricoides (also called Giant roundworm) about 15 cm in length. They can grow up to 40 cm and cause the disease ascariasis in humans. Other species of ascaris can infect other animals, including pigs, horses, and cows. Image credit: CDC Division of Parasitic Diseases.

The helminths are invertebrates characterized by elongated, flat or round bodies. In medically oriented schemes the flatworms or platyhelminths (platy from the Greek root meaning “flat”) include flukes and tapeworms. Define: Helminth – The term helminth means worm, and applies to parasitic worms; these may be flat (flukes/tapeworms) or round (hookworms, Ascaris worms, filarial worms, etc.). Definitive host – The definitive host is where sexual reproduction of a parasite takes place. In the case of multicellular … man tip of the day
